About Google Apps for Business

Google Apps for Business (now Google Workspace) is Google's suite of productivity and collaboration tools for businesses, including Gmail, Google Drive, Docs, Sheets, Meet, and Calendar, hosted on Google's infrastructure.

How does Web Reveal detect Google Apps for Business?

Web Reveal identifies Google Apps for Business by inspecting a combination of signals: JavaScript global variables and library fingerprints loaded in the page, distinctive patterns in HTML markup and meta tags, HTTP response headers such as X-Powered-By and Server, asset file paths and CDN URLs, and cookie names set by the technology. This multi-signal approach minimizes false positives and ensures accurate results even when sites obscure their stack.
